The purpose of this study is to assess the long-term treatment of patients with proximal venous thrombosis through the administration of subcutaneous low-molecular-weight heparin (tinzaparin sodium) versus the standard care use of intravenous heparin followed by oral warfarin sodium.
Full description
The accepted treatment for acute deep vein thrombosis (DVT) is initial continuous intravenous heparin followed by long-term oral anticoagulant therapy. Improvements in the methods of clinical trials and the use of accurate objective tests to detect venous thromboembolism have made it possible to perform a series of randomized trials to evaluate various treatments of venous thromboembolism.
